The Basics of Commercial Lease Management

Lease management is a series of actions that allow landlords to draft and enforce lease agreements. Commercial property owners outline rental terms to business owners and managers before they sign.

After leasing the building out to tenants, the lease serves as a set of guidelines for behavior on the property, rental payments, and the length of time the tenant is required to remain in the building.

Good lease management strategies mean drafting up ironclad legal agreements. You need to negotiate with tenants and come to mutually agreeable terms before incorporating them into a lease to sign.

This lease should be accessible to both you and your tenants so that everyone has transparent access to its terms and wording. It also needs to be clear about penalties for breaking the lease.

Without a good management strategy, lease administration will be challenging, disorganized, and nearly impossible.

Tools, Tips, and Tricks

Lease management software comes in many shapes and sizes with lease drafting templates being one of the most important.

Expert-created leases will already have all technicalities taken care of to protect you if a lawsuit or breach happens. Lease signing within an integrated all-in-one dashboard also keeps you organized, and the dashboard makes the lease easily accessible on both landlord and tenant mobile devices.

Automated renewal tracking and notifications also make it easy for you to offer new leases to commercial tenants whose previous agreements are about to expire. This makes tenant retention easy and decreases vacancy rates.
